    Maranello, as the saying goes is about "fast cars, slow life...

    Maranello, as the saying goes is about "fast cars, slow life". And that is exactly what you will find.... Ferrari is of course the major attraction, and if you are a fan, it is a 100% immersive experience. We also came to dine at Massimo Botero's restaurant, Cavallino, situated at Ferrari - and it was simply awesome, exactly what we expected. Talking of food - the brakfast at our B&B (Villa Esther) was simply superb. And the DolceCrema Gelataria in the centre of the town, offers the best Gelato we tasted in a month long trip to Tuscany and Florence. The town itself is small, mostly flat, and easily walkable. We took a bus from Modena to Maranello - it is a short ride, but there are taxis operating too.

    Maranello is not just about Ferrari, although they are the...

    Maranello is not just about Ferrari, although they are the high profile local interest, with the factory, museum and other aspects of interest. It is a nice little town situated in a rural agricultural area of Italy, south of Modena. There are plenty of cafes and restaurants to visit and the place has a nice atmosphere.
